Description of Business and Basis of Presentation | Description of Business and Basis of Presentation Description of Business
Dollar Tree, Inc. (“we,” “our,” “us,” or “the Company”) is a leading operator of discount retail stores in the United States and Canada.
Basis of Presentation
The accompanying consolidated financial statements include the financial statements of Dollar Tree, Inc., and its wholly-owned subsidiaries and were prepared in accordance with accounting principles generally accepted in the United States of America (“U.S. GAAP”). All intercompany balances and transactions have been eliminated in consolidation. All amounts stated herein are in U.S. Dollars. Continuing operations consists of the Dollar Tree segment and corporate, support and other.
Fiscal Year Our fiscal year is a 52-week or 53-week period ending on the Saturday closest to January 31. References to “fiscal 2026,” “fiscal 2025,” “fiscal 2024,” and “fiscal 2022,” relate to the 52-week fiscal years ended January 30, 2027, January 31, 2026, February 1, 2025, and January 28, 2023, respectively.
